UPVC Door Hinge Replacement

UPVC doors offer durability and security and are a popular choice for homeowners. However, with time, the hinges could become loose and not aligned. This can cause leaks and draughts.

To avoid this issue, homeowners should maintain their UPVC doors with regular cleaning and lubrication. Use industrial Vaseline, or other lubricants.

Cost

UPVC hinges are made in a variety of designs and are used to join the frame of a door with sash. They are designed to hold weight and provide smooth operation. UPVC hinges are available in different sizes and materials. It is crucial to pick the right one for you.

The most common uPVC hinges are known as butt hinges. They are made up of two hinge leaves (or plates) and the hinge pin. Both of the hinge leaves have holes for screws, which help them stay in place. The hinge pin is fitted through the knuckles, and assists in keeping both plates together.

There are a few reasons why your uPVC doors might not close properly. The most common cause is that the hinges are not aligned properly. You can fix this by loosening the screws, and then adjusting them. Another reason could be that the latch does not hold onto the strike plate. In this instance it's recommended to call a professional who can inspect and adjust the latching mechanism.

Most uPVC doors have hinges that can be adjusted to allow you to adjust the alignment and clearance of your door. This can improve the appearance and operation of your door, as well as help prevent water leaks. Lubricate hinges to ensure they move smoothly.

The safety and performance of your door depends on the kind of hinge you choose. The three most popular types are rebated, butt and flag hinges. Flag hinges attach to the edge of a door while butt hinges fit inside holes in the frame of the door. Rebated hinges can be hard to find, but they are simple to set up and adjust.

You can make use of a fixing tool to ensure that the sash is placed in a central position on the frame. It is also a good idea to test the sash's weight on each of the 3 hinges. When you are certain that the sash is weighted equally on all hinges, it is time to secure it to the door.

Install x3 hinges for flags onto the standard uPVC Sash. The top hinge should be situated 150mm from the top edge of the sash. The bottom hinge should be placed 150mm from the bottom edge, and the middle hinge should be set equally between the two outer hinges.

There are a variety of different kinds of uPVC door hinges on the market, and each type comes with its own distinctive features. The type of hinge you select will be determined by your budget and needs. The most common hinges for doors made of uPVC include flag or T hinges, as well as butt hinges. Flag hinges are the most popular and are present on modern uPVC doors. These hinges are designed to support a larger sash, and permit horizontal and vertical adjustments.

T hinges are like flag hinges and can be adjusted vertically and horizontally. Butt hinges on the other hand, are usually found on older doors, and are only capable of adjusting laterally.

Doors made of uPVC and their hardware are made to last, but they can still be subject to wear and tear. They are exposed to harsh weather conditions, everyday traffic and use and can begin to squeak or wiggle. This issue can be fixed by adjusting the hinges, or by replacing them completely.

One of the most frequent problems with uPVC doors is that the hinges are misaligned. This could be due to normal wear and tear or dirt and debris. It is possible to correct the issue by using a screwdriver as well as an allen key to adjust the hinges. Turning the screw counterclockwise will loosen the sash and lower it.
